3 changes: 3 additions & 0 deletions gson/src/main/java/com/google/gson/stream/JsonWriter.java
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-498,6 +498,9 @@ public JsonWriter name(String name) throws IOException {
if (stackSize == 0) {
throw new IllegalStateException("JsonWriter is closed.");
}
if (stackSize == 1 && (peek() == EMPTY_DOCUMENT || peek() == NONEMPTY_DOCUMENT)) {
throw new IllegalStateException("Please begin an object before this.");
}
deferredName = name;
return this;
}
